Julia Tapia Villicana was born in 1994, age 30. Julia Tapia Villicana's address is 1215 Westminster Avenue , Palo Alto, CA 94303. Possible relatives include Horacio Tapia, Julia Tapia and 2 others.
Address History: 1215 Westminster Avenue, Palo Alto, CA 94303
Results 1 - 1 of 1